hey guys , wanna ask about macbook white removable battery. i heard that it expands after a few months and dies after a year . is that true? thinkin of getting a macbook white
*
Hi there, don't remove the battery if possible, just leave it there, itll stop charging when it's full so no worries. Regarding the defect of battery, only a few ppl face the prob, mine is still gd after using for nearly 1 year, but no worries, you can claim a new batt if it really swells. The battery dies normally after 400-500 cycles, if you use it frequently then of coz it will die faster that's normal. My health health is still 90% and only 80 cycles smile.gif
